Estimating Waste Volume



To accurately select the ideal dimension Skip container for your job, you have to first approximate the quantity of waste you'll be getting rid of. One method to do this is by visually checking the things you prepare to throw out and about estimating their complete volume in cubic meters.

Conversely, you can utilize online devices or waste volume calculators to aid you establish the approximate quantity of waste you'll have. Bear in mind that it's much better to a little overstate than to underestimate, as it's even more economical to work with a somewhat larger Skip container than to order an extra one if you run out of room.



If you're still not sure, think about seeking advice from waste administration specialists that can give support based upon the kind of project you're taking on. By precisely approximating your waste quantity, you'll be better geared up to choose the ideal Skip bin dimension for your requirements.

Comprehending Bin Capacities



Comprehending bin measurements is critical when choosing the ideal Skip bin size for your project. Skip containers been available in various dimensions, commonly determined in cubic meters.

The measurements of an avoid container refer to its size, size, and height. By understanding these measurements, you can imagine just how much waste the container can hold and whether it will match your requirements.

As an example, a 2 cubic meter Skip bin may have dimensions of approximately 1.8 meters in length, 1.4 meters in width, and 0.9 meters in height. Understanding these measurements can aid you determine if the Skip bin will certainly fit in your preferred location and if it can fit the quantity of waste you prepare for producing.

Always take into consideration the space you have offered for the Skip container and ensure that its measurements straighten with your project demands to stay clear of any type of problems throughout waste disposal.
